In the future, trains will operate fully driverless GoA4 mode when sufficient reliability from the signaling system has been confirmed.

The north extension will head to Airport North (Terminal 2) in Huadu District of Guangzhou while the southern extension will connect to Guangmingcheng railway station in Shenzhen, becoming an express line "connecting sea, land and air" with a total length of 128.8 kilometres (80.03 mi).

[9] The North extension of Line 22 will be 41.1 km (25.54 mi) in length with 10 new stations and be fully underground.

[12][13] In 2020, Guangzhou Metro began soliciting bids to further investigate the extension of Line 22 into Dongguan and Shenzhen.

[9] When complete a number of different services and express and local stopping patterns will be operated, including Shenzhen/Dongguan to Baiyun Station, Nansha Passenger Ferry Terminal to Baiyun Airport North, Nansha Passenger Port to Huachengjie, etc.
